    Step 1: Identify Your Room and Style Needs

    Before diving into options, define the purpose and style of your space. For a nursery, soft pastel decals with a matte finish and gentle adhesives are ideal. For kitchens, vibrant, waterproof vinyl stickers with easy-to-clean surfaces work best. In bathrooms, look for moisture-resistant decals that handle humidity well. Renters should focus on decals with removable and damage-free adhesive, while families might prioritize durability for high-traffic areas.

    **Measurement Tips:** Use a measuring tape or ruler to determine the size of the wall space. For small areas, choose decals under 12 inches; for larger walls, aim for decals over 24 inches to make a visual impact. Remember to account for furniture placement so decals complement rather than clutter your space.

    Step 2: Consider Material and Finish

    Material choice affects appearance, durability, and ease of application/removal:
    – **Vinyl**: durable, waterproof, suitable for high-humidity areas. Available in matte, satin, or gloss finishes.
    – **Fabric or Paper Stickers**: often more delicate, good for temporary decor or low-moisture areas.
    – **Eco-friendly options**: made from self-adhesive paper or biodegradable vinyl, ideal for eco-conscious families.

    **Finish Selection:** Matte finishes hide fingerprints and glare, ideal for bedrooms and nurseries. Gloss finishes enhance colors and are perfect for kitchens and kids’ playrooms.

    Step 3: Assess Surface Compatibility and Adhesion

    Not all surfaces are suitable for every decal type:
    – **Smooth surfaces** like painted drywall, glass, or vinyl are easiest for decals to stick onto.
    – **Textured walls** may require decals with stronger adhesive or specialized textured vinyl.
    – **Rental Walls:** look for decals with removable adhesive that won’t damage paint or leave residue.

    **Installation Tips:**
    – Clean the wall thoroughly to remove dust, grease, or soap residue.
    – Avoid applying decals to freshly painted walls—wait at least two weeks.
    – Use a level or tape as a guide for straight application.

    Step 4: Ensure Easy Removability and Damage-Free Removal

    For rentals and mess-free removal, choose decals specifically designed for easy peel-off without damaging surfaces. Look for features like:
    – Removable adhesive
    – Low-tack peel-away backing
    – No harsh chemicals needed during removal

    **Removal Process:**
    – Gently peel from one corner, pulling slowly at a 45-degree angle.
    – Use heat from a hairdryer if decals are stubborn.
    – Clean residual adhesive with a mild soap solution or alcohol-based cleaner.

    Step 5: Consider Practicalities and Room-Specific Tips

    Different rooms require tailored decor solutions:
    – **Nursery & Kids’ Rooms:** Fun shapes, characters, and motivational quotes in non-toxic, eco-friendly vinyl. Ensure decals are safe for children, free from harmful chemicals, and easy to remove when growth or preferences change.
    – **Kitchens:** Waterproof, grease-resistant decals with vibrant colors. Avoid decals that peel or fade due to heat or steam.
    – **Bathrooms:** Moisture-resistant decals made from waterproof vinyl are essential. Avoid paper-based options that can warp or peel.

    **Measuring Tips:** For smaller decals, use painter’s tape first to visualize placement. For murals or large decals, mark on the wall with a pencil to guide precise application.

    Step 6: Make the Final Choice and Prepare for Application

    Once you’ve narrowed down your options based on style, material, surface compatibility, and removal features, prepare for a smooth installation:
    – Gather tools such as a squeegee or credit card for smooth application.
    – Follow manufacturer instructions for adhesion and curing times.
    – Patience in the application process ensures a professional look.

    For removal or repositioning, always proceed gently to prevent damage and save decals for future reuse or repositioning.

    Installation and Removal Tips for Safety and Longevity

    – Always clean the surface thoroughly before applying decals.
    – Apply decals slowly, smoothing out air bubbles with a squeegee or credit card.
    – For removals, warm the decal slightly with a hairdryer to soften adhesive and peel gently.
    – Avoid forced removal to prevent paint chipping or wall damage.

    Installation Tips for a Perfect Finish

    Getting decals to stick securely and look flawless involves some tricks, especially if you’re working around textured or uneven walls:

    1. **Surface Preparation:** Clean walls thoroughly with mild soap and water to remove dust, grease, or oils. Residue can reduce adhesion.
    2. **Temperature & Humidity:** Install decals in a room with moderate temperature and low humidity for better sticking power.
    3. **Measuring & Planning:** Use painter’s tape and a level to align decals before peeling off the backing.
    4. **Applying the Decal:** Start from one corner and gently press down, smoothing out air bubbles with a squeegee or credit card.

    Removing and Repositioning Tips

    For renters especially, ease of removal is crucial. Most decals are designed for stress-free removal:

    – **Gentle Peeling:** Slowly peel from one corner, pulling at a low angle to minimize wall paint disturbance.
    – **Heat Application:** Use a hairdryer to warm the decal slightly; heat softens the adhesive for easier removal.
    – **Residue Removal:** If any adhesive residue remains, clean with gentle rubbing alcohol or an adhesive remover safe for Painted walls.

    Repositionable decals often have a low-tack adhesive that allows multiple repositionings, making them perfect for changing decor.
